How Credit Boost Works: A Clear, Neutral Explanation
At its core, Credit Boost refers to initiatives and services that help improve credit health by monitoring, tracking, and strategically addressing factors that impact credit scores. This includes reviewing credit reports for errors, managing payment consistency, and using repayment tools to build a stronger credit history. Rather than manipulating data, modern Credit Boost solutions focus on education, timely payments, and responsible credit use to boost confidence and score potential.
These tools often connect users to real-time account insights, payment reminders, credit monitoring, and debt management resources—empowering individuals to take proactive control without compromising financial integrity.

Why is Credit Boost different from a credit hack or loophole?
Credit Boost is grounded in legitimate financial practices—focusing on accuracy, transparency, and long-term habits rather than misleading tactics.
Can Credit Boost raise my score quickly?
While improvements take time, consistent, mindful actions—like on-time payments and reduced credit utilization—can create measurable progress over months, not days.
Is Credit Boost safe and legitimate?
Top-rated services follow strict data privacy standards and align with fair credit reporting laws, minimizing risk when chosen carefully.
Who should consider Credit Boost?
Anyone with fair or recovering credit, recent credit challenges, or simply seeking clearer financial direction can benefit from structured, honest Credit Boost approaches.
